Right to wind up partnership affairs. Except as provided in the partnership agreement, the general partners who have not wrongfully dissolved a limited partnership or, if none, the limited partners, may wind up the limited partnership's affairs; but the Superior Court may wind up the limited partnership's affairs upon application of any partner, his legal representative, or assignee. L. 1983, c. 489, s. 52, eff. April 1, 1985.
